
A visit by the Counsellor for Research and Innovation at the European Union Delegation to the United States in Washington, D.C. provided valuable opportunities for the University of Hawaiʻi at 惭ā苍辞补 to access funding, foster strategic collaborations, expand its international network, and support the professional development of its faculty and students.

The 东精影业 惭ā苍辞补 (OVPRS) hosted the EU delegation visit in March 2024, which included Florent Bernard, EU Counsellor for Research and Innovation, and Jeffrey Lau, Belgian Honorary Consul. Bernard presented at an OVPRS faculty forum to discuss the new EU research and innovation program 2021–27 called .
“The Horizon Europe mission connects very well with priority areas in Hawaiʻi,” said 东精影业 惭ā苍辞补 Interim Vice Provost for Research and Scholarship Christopher Sabine. “Partnering can provide a powerful diverse perspective that will strengthen both of our regions.”

During their visit to 东精影业 惭ā苍辞补, Bernard and Lau met with campus leadership to discuss potential strategic collaborations. In addition, Bernard visited with faculty and staff from the Kewalo Marine Laboratory, 东精影业 Cancer Center, John A. Burns School of Medicine and Social Sciences Research Institute.
Horizon Europe is a new program and will help 东精影业 惭ā苍辞补 faculty to forge international collaborations and join collaborative networks to enhance 东精影业’s research presence across the globe. Through this program, 东精影业 惭ā苍辞补 can also receive funding for graduate students and postdocs through doctoral networks and fellowships.
